How can I lose weight in winter?

2 minutes, 36 seconds Read

As the winter chill sets in, the temptation to indulge in hearty comfort foods and hibernate indoors becomes stronger. However, maintaining a healthy weight during the winter months is essential for overall well-being. In this article, we’ll explore effective strategies to help you lose weight and stay fit during the winter season.

  1. Stay Active:

Cold weather might make outdoor activities less appealing, but staying active is crucial for weight loss. Consider indoor exercises such as home workouts, yoga, or joining a local gym. Additionally, winter sports like skiing, ice skating, and snowshoeing can provide a fun and effective way to burn calories.

  1. Choose Seasonal and Nutrient-Rich Foods:

Embrace winter produce and opt for nutrient-dense foods to support your weight loss goals. Incorporate a variety of colorful fruits and vegetables, whole grains, lean proteins, and healthy fats into your meals. Experiment with soups, stews, and hot salads to enjoy nutritious and warming options.

  1. Stay Hydrated:

It’s easy to forget about staying hydrated during the colder months, but proper hydration is crucial for weight loss. Drink plenty of water throughout the day and consider herbal teas or warm lemon water to add flavor without extra calories. Avoid excessive consumption of sugary beverages and high-calorie hot drinks.

  1. Control Portion Sizes:

Winter often brings festive gatherings and holiday feasts, making it easy to overindulge. Practice mindful eating by paying attention to portion sizes and savoring each bite. Use smaller plates to help control portions and avoid going back for seconds.

  1. Plan Healthy Comfort Foods:

Swap traditional high-calorie comfort foods for healthier alternatives. Opt for roasted vegetables, lean proteins, and whole grains instead of calorie-laden casseroles and heavy desserts. Experiment with herbs and spices to add flavor without excess calories.

  1. Prioritize Sleep:

Adequate sleep is essential for weight management. Aim for 7-9 hours of quality sleep each night to support your body’s natural metabolism and hormonal balance. Lack of sleep can lead to increased cravings and a higher likelihood of overeating.

  1. Find Indoor Workouts:

If outdoor activities are not appealing, explore indoor workout options. Many fitness apps and online platforms offer a variety of home workouts that require minimal equipment. Create a consistent workout routine to stay active and boost your metabolism.

  1. Set Realistic Goals:

Establish realistic and achievable weight loss goals for the winter season. Break down larger goals into smaller, manageable steps, and celebrate your successes along the way. This approach will help you stay motivated and focused on your weight loss journey.

Losing weight during the winter requires a combination of healthy lifestyle choices, including regular exercise, a balanced diet, and mindful eating habits. By staying active, making nutritious food choices, and prioritizing self-care, you can achieve and maintain a healthy weight even when the temperatures drop. Remember that small, sustainable changes are key to long-term success.
